Mounted the used wheel i got from MIA, holy crap it EATS rocks!
I wore down a crappy obsidian to dress the face of the grinding wheel (as per instructions after showing it to my neighbor glen)
He said wear down a large chunk of crap obsidian, it will dress the worn areas and make it eat anything you put to it for lunch, so i did.
My imperial jasper basically bounces off my 180 grit,
I set some to the worn 80, oh i love it!
Going to be awesome for shaping cabs!
